Transaction d25761116c16a21a936f71dce571db1b5d6d4f4fb2292e6e19b5ea7c28f77690
3 Input
1 Outputs
- d25761116c16a21a936f71dce571db1b5d6d4f4fb2292e6e19b5ea7c28f77690:0
value 45827
address 38xn3zgnqpkKrLXKhU86MbCt1KriL6Fj46